One phone, two brains: that was the Galaxy S24 launch in January 2024. Samsung shipped the S24 and S24 Plus with its own Exynos 2400 in Europe, the UK, India, South Korea, Bangladesh and most other markets, while buyers in the US, Canada, China, Taiwan and Hong Kong got Qualcomm's Snapdragon 8 Gen 3 for Galaxy, per Android Authority's country list. The S24 Ultra carried the Snapdragon everywhere, and the S24 FE shipped worldwide with a slightly slower chip called the Exynos 2400e.

Why This Matters
The Exynos versus Snapdragon split decides what a buyer actually gets for the same money, and in the S24 generation the two chips were unusually close in CPU work while remaining far apart in graphics. Knowing where the gap sat matters for anyone buying a used Galaxy today or comparing the new 2026 split.
The generation also set the template Samsung still follows in 2026: Qualcomm for North America and Greater China, in-house silicon for everyone else, including Bangladesh. That is why this history keeps repeating.
Main Story
The S24 generation was Samsung's first true dual-chip flagship year since the criticized Exynos 2200 era of the Galaxy S22. After the Snapdragon-only Galaxy S23, which even Samsung's home market received, the S24 put the 4nm Exynos 2400, with a 10-core CPU and AMD-based Xclipse 940 graphics, back into most of the world, and kept the TSMC-built Snapdragon 8 Gen 3 for Galaxy in the five markets where Qualcomm partnerships run deepest.

Before the scores, one honest limitation, stated up front. Because Samsung never offered both chips in one country, every published CPU and GPU comparison pairs an Exynos S24 or S24 Plus against the Snapdragon S24 Ultra, which is a different phone with a bigger body and more thermal headroom. Treat the deltas as indicative, not lab-grade equivalents. The one true same-body comparison of the generation came from Android Authority, which tested both S24 variants separately and is flagged where used below.
What each Galaxy S24 phone actually scored, Geekbench 6:
On those numbers, from HiTechCentury's phone tests, the Snapdragon unit leads by roughly 7 percent single-core and 4 percent multi-core, matching NotebookCheck's early comparison of development units, which measured an 8 percent and 4 percent lead. The FE's underclocked 2400e sits a further 5 percent behind the full 2400, per Nanoreview and 91mobiles data.
The full-gap picture needs graphics. In AnTuTu 11 aggregates at Nanoreview, a crowd-sourced database rather than a single lab, the Snapdragon averages 2.35 million against the Exynos 2.05 million, a 15 percent total gap, while the CPU sub-scores are nearly tied at around 700,000 each. The entire difference sits in the GPU sub-score, where the Adreno 750 leads the Xclipse 940 by about 26 percent. In HiTechCentury's 3DMark runs, the Snapdragon Ultra phone won Wild Life Extreme by roughly a third, 4,043 against 3,047, yet the Exynos S24 narrowly edged the Ultra in the ray tracing test, Solar Bay, 8,072 to 7,782, a margin of about 4 percent. Ray tracing remains a synthetic measure with limited game support, so treat it as a curiosity rather than a purchase argument.

Then came the generation's biggest plot twist, and it was not about speed. Android Authority ran the only documented same-body comparison, testing both S24 variants across real workloads, and found the Exynos phone lasting 36 percent longer in automated web browsing, with leads of at least 15 percent in most battery tests, while the Snapdragon unit lasted 16 percent longer while recording 4K video. Their verdict: marginally higher gaming performance for Snapdragon buyers, better battery life for most everyday tasks on Exynos. This measured result cuts against the forum-level assumption that Exynos automatically means worse battery, and the site noted similar outcomes in older pairs like the Snapdragon 888 versus Exynos 2100.
Cameras tell a quieter version of the same story. The hardware is identical across variants, same sensors and lenses, but image processing differs because the ISP differs. Historically this fueled real complaints, and DxOMark found the S22 Ultra's two variants scoring the same overall with small category differences. For the S24 generation, Android Authority's roundup of independent comparisons describes a close fight, with one reviewer preferring Exynos main shots and low-light telephoto video, another preferring Snapdragon ultrawides, and DxOMark so far having published results only for the Snapdragon variant.
Beyond raw specs, two more differences shaped the debate. Samsung forums carried overheating and battery complaints about the Exynos 2400 through 2024, as Android Police noted, though no major lab corroborated a thermal gap, and Android Police's separate reporting stressed Exynos reliability was not the reason for the foldable decisions below. On software, both variants followed the same documented update schedule, reaching One UI 8 in September 2025 with seven years of support promised, per Wikipedia's tracked update history.

The Flip 7 line deserves its own sentence, because it is the strangest move in the table: after The Elec explained that foldable volumes were too low to justify two chips in 2024, Samsung reversed course entirely in 2025 and shipped the Z Flip 7 with the Exynos 2500 in every market, including the United States and China, the first Galaxy Flip to drop Qualcomm completely, before returning to a regional split for the Z Flip 8 in 2026.
Two footnotes complete the record. In September 2025, Samsung relaunched the smaller Galaxy S24 in India with the Snapdragon 8 Gen 3 inside, an India-exclusive re-release covered by Hindustan Times and Digit, sold through Flipkart's Big Billion Days sale from a listed price of Rs 74,999 and teased under Rs 40,000 during the sale; the phone was never re-released in the US or Europe, where the Exynos version remained the only S24 sold. And the S24 FE, the popular mid-range entry, ran the slower Exynos 2400e everywhere, scoring around 2,050 single-core and 6,400 multi-core, roughly 5 percent behind the full 2400.

FAQ
Which Galaxy phones used the Exynos 2400?
The Galaxy S24 and S24 Plus in most world markets, including Europe, the UK, India, Bangladesh and South Korea, and the Galaxy S24 FE everywhere in its slightly slower 2400e form. The S24 Ultra used the Snapdragon 8 Gen 3 in every market.
How big is the gap between Exynos 2400 and Snapdragon 8 Gen 3?
In Geekbench 6, roughly 7 percent single-core and 4 percent multi-core, though those runs pair the Exynos S24 against the different-body S24 Ultra. In AnTuTu 11 aggregates, about 15 percent in total, driven almost entirely by a GPU sub-score gap of around 26 percent.
Which one has better battery life?
In Android Authority's same-body comparison, the Exynos S24 lasted 36 percent longer in web browsing and led most tests by at least 15 percent, while the Snapdragon unit lasted 16 percent longer recording 4K video. For typical daily workloads, the tested advantage went to the Exynos.
Do the Exynos and Snapdragon S24 cameras differ?
The hardware is identical, but image processing differs slightly. DxOMark scored both Galaxy S22 Ultra variants the same overall, and independent S24 comparisons collected by Android Authority describe a close fight with small, scene-dependent wins for each variant. No authoritative lab has published a full side-by-side for the S24.
Did Exynos phones get updates later?
Not in this generation. Both S24 variants followed the same documented update schedule, including One UI 8 in September 2025, with seven years of support promised for the whole line.
Is the Exynos 2400 good for gaming?
For most games, yes, and it narrowly won a 3DMark ray tracing test against the Snapdragon Ultra phone. For sustained rasterized graphics, the Snapdragon's Adreno 750 stays clearly ahead, winning Wild Life Extreme by about a third.
Why did Samsung put Snapdragon in the S24 only in five markets?
Qualcomm partnerships and carrier certification run deepest in the US, Canada, China, Taiwan and Hong Kong, and Samsung has historically reserved Snapdragon for those regions whenever it offers both chips, a pattern the S24 repeated and the 2026 lineup still follows.
Bottom Line
The Exynos 2400 vs Snapdragon 8 Gen 3 generation ended in a split decision: Samsung's chip closed the CPU gap to single digits, won the same-body battery comparison by a wide margin, and still lost the total-score fight by about 15 percent on the strength of a 26 percent GPU deficit.
